Common Tarmac Repair Service Jobs
Tarmac Repair - restoring damaged or cracked asphalt surfaces for safety and appearance.
Pothole Filling - repairing potholes to prevent further deterioration and vehicle damage.
Crack Sealing - sealing surface cracks to prevent water infiltration and asphalt breakdown.
Surface Resurfacing - applying new asphalt to improve the look and longevity of existing pavement.
Edge Repair - fixing crumbling or uneven edges along driveways and walkways.
Sealcoating - protecting asphalt surfaces from weather and wear through protective coating application.
Tarmac Repair Service Questions
What types of damage can tarmac repair address? Tarmac repair can fix cracks, potholes, and surface deterioration to restore a smooth, safe driveway or parking area.
Is tarmac repair suitable for driveways and parking lots? Yes, tarmac repair is effective for both residential driveways and commercial parking areas to maintain functionality and appearance.
What should property owners know before scheduling tarmac repair? Proper surface preparation and assessment are important to ensure the repair blends seamlessly with the existing surface.
Can tarmac repair extend the lifespan of an existing surface? Yes, timely repairs can help prevent further damage and prolong the usability of the tarmac surface.
